Hey, I’m looking for a bit of help and advice, and hopefully good news!
I’d started some trading and wanted to keep it manageable and affordable.
Things were going good until I tried to withdraw some profits and turn tokens into pounds.
The advisor kept shifting me from wallet to wallet, having to pay in more and more liquidity (gasses) each time, which in itself built up significantly.
I’m now stuck whereby I can’t afford the last request of gasses to finalise the withdrawal.
Is this right, is it normal, or is it a big fat scam?
What platform are you using?
With normal ones like Coinbase or Kraken it should be pretty easy, one step conversion and withdrawal.
Might be that you chose a bad platform to trade (possibly a scam).
